Question: What is the primary pollutant in photochemical smog?

Options:

  1. Carbon monoxide
  2. Nitrogen oxides
  3. Ozone
  4. Sulfur dioxide

Correct Answer: Ozone

Solution:

Ozone is a key component of photochemical smog, formed by the reaction of sunlight with pollutants like nitrogen oxides.

What is the primary pollutant in photochemical smog?
Correct Answer: Ozone
  • Step 1: Understand what photochemical smog is. It is a type of air pollution that occurs when sunlight reacts with certain pollutants in the atmosphere.
  • Step 2: Identify the main pollutants that contribute to photochemical smog. These include nitrogen oxides and volatile organic compounds.
  • Step 3: Learn how ozone is formed. Ozone is created when sunlight reacts with nitrogen oxides and other pollutants.
  • Step 4: Conclude that ozone is the primary pollutant in photochemical smog because it is a significant component formed during this reaction.
